The Delhi APP Written Exam Pattern 2025 assesses candidates' understanding of core legal frameworks and their ability to interpret and apply them effectively. This stage comprises 100 objective-type questions based on major criminal laws and legal procedures relevant to public prosecution.
Delhi APP Written Exam Pattern 2025 |
|
Component |
Details |
Type of Exam |
Objective (Multiple Choice Questions) |
Subjects Covered |
Criminal Law, IPC (BNS), CrPC (BNSS), Evidence Act (BSA) |
Total Questions |
100 Questions |
Total Marks |
100 Marks |
Duration |
2 Hours |
Medium of Examination |
English Only |
Negative Marking |
Yes (1/3 mark deducted for each incorrect answer) |
Mode of Examination |
Offline/OMR Based (as per official notification) |
Qualifying Criteria |
Minimum 40% marks required to qualify |
This stage tests legal aptitude, reasoning skills, and familiarity with prosecutorial laws and procedures.
Candidates who qualify for the written examination appear for the interview stage. The Delhi APP Interview Exam Pattern 2025 evaluates not only subject knowledge but also communication skills, decision-making ability, and suitability for the role of Assistant Public Prosecutor.
Delhi APP Interview Exam Pattern 2025 |
|
Component |
Details |
Type of Exam |
Personal Interview |
Marks Allotted |
100 Marks |
Medium of Communication |
English |
Assessment Criteria |
Communication skills, Legal reasoning, Subject knowledge |
Panel Composition |
Senior Legal Experts/Judicial Officers |
Purpose |
Evaluate practical knowledge, analytical ability, and conduct |
Weightage in Final Merit |
50% (out of a total of 200 marks) |
Areas of Evaluation:
Legal Reasoning
Problem-solving in criminal scenarios
Recent case laws and amendments
Professional attitude and communication clarity
The interview panel usually comprises senior legal professionals or judicial officers who assess the candidate's readiness to handle public prosecution responsibilities.

To qualify for each stage, candidates must secure the Delhi Assistant Public Prosecutor Qualifying Marks 2025. Although exact cut-offs may vary, candidates are expected to score a minimum percentage to be eligible for the interview and final selection.
Typically, the qualifying benchmark includes:
Written Test: Minimum 40% to qualify (subject to category-specific relaxations)
Interview: Performance-based assessment—combined score with written test considered for final merit
